Are you struggling to automate your global marketing tasks with Python scripts in PowerShell? Many marketers face challenges when running Python automation scripts across different regions due to IP restrictions and technical complexities. This guide will show you how to run a Python script in PowerShell effectively while leveraging LIKE.TG's residential proxy IPs to overcome geo-restrictions and scale your international campaigns.
By combining PowerShell's automation capabilities with Python's marketing libraries and LIKE.TG's 35 million clean residential IPs (priced as low as $0.2/GB), you can create powerful cross-border marketing solutions that work seamlessly across all target markets.
How to Run a Python Script in PowerShell for Marketing Automation
1. Core Value: Running Python scripts in PowerShell allows marketers to combine Windows automation with Python's rich ecosystem of marketing libraries (like BeautifulSoup for web scraping or Pandas for data analysis). When paired with LIKE.TG residential proxies, you can execute location-specific campaigns at scale without triggering anti-bot protections.
2. Key Findings: Our tests show that marketing automation scripts run 37% more reliably when executed through PowerShell with residential proxies compared to direct connections. The combination provides better control over execution environments while maintaining natural traffic patterns.
3. Implementation Benefits: Marketers gain the ability to schedule Python-powered campaigns (like ad testing or social media automation) through PowerShell's Task Scheduler while rotating proxies to simulate organic user behavior from different locations.
Setting Up Your Python-PowerShell Marketing Environment
1. Technical Setup: First ensure Python is added to your system PATH. Then in PowerShell, you can run scripts using either python script.py or py script.py. For marketing automation, we recommend virtual environments to manage dependencies cleanly.
2. Proxy Integration: Incorporate LIKE.TG proxies into your Python scripts using the requests library with proxy authentication. This allows each script execution to originate from different residential IPs in your target markets.
3. Execution Monitoring: Use PowerShell's logging capabilities (Start-Transcript) to track script performance and proxy success rates. Our case studies show proper logging reduces troubleshooting time by 62%.
Practical Applications for Global Marketers
1. Case Study 1: An e-commerce brand used PowerShell-scheduled Python scripts with LIKE.TG's US residential proxies to test localized ad copy variations across 15 regions, resulting in a 28% CTR improvement.
2. Case Study 2: A SaaS company automated their competitive price monitoring by running Python scripts through PowerShell with rotating German residential proxies, identifying pricing trends 3 days faster than competitors.
3. Case Study 3: An affiliate marketer combined PowerShell's scheduling with Python's Selenium automation and LIKE.TG proxies to manage 50 social media accounts with unique IPs, increasing engagement by 41% without flagging.
Optimizing Your Marketing Automation Workflow
1. Performance Tips: Use PowerShell's -WindowStyle Hidden parameter to run scripts in the background. Combine this with Python's async libraries and proxy rotation for maximum efficiency in large-scale campaigns.
2. Error Handling: Implement robust try-catch blocks in your Python code and configure PowerShell to retry failed executions automatically. LIKE.TG's proxy API makes it easy to switch IPs when encountering blocks.
3. Scalability: For enterprise marketing operations, consider running PowerShell scripts on Azure Automation with LIKE.TG's dedicated proxy pools to maintain consistent performance across thousands of executions.
We LIKE Provide How to Run a Python Script in PowerShell Solutions
1. Our technical team has developed ready-to-use PowerShell/Python templates specifically configured for marketing automation with built-in proxy rotation through LIKE.TG's API.
2. We offer dedicated support to help marketers troubleshoot script execution issues and optimize proxy configurations for different marketing platforms and regions.
Summary
Mastering how to run a Python script in PowerShell with residential proxies unlocks powerful capabilities for global marketers. The combination provides reliable automation, geo-targeting precision, and scalability that's essential in today's competitive international markets. LIKE.TG's proxy solutions ensure your marketing automation works consistently across all regions while maintaining the appearance of organic traffic.
LIKE.TG discovers global marketing software & marketing services, providing the marketing tools & services needed for overseas expansion, helping businesses achieve precise marketing promotion.
Frequently Asked Questions
1. Why should I run Python scripts through PowerShell instead of directly?
PowerShell provides superior scheduling, logging, and system integration capabilities compared to running Python directly. For marketing automation, this means better control over execution timing, error handling, and resource management - especially when coordinating multiple scripts across different time zones.
2. How do LIKE.TG residential proxies improve my marketing automation?
Our 35 million clean residential IPs prevent your automation from being flagged as bot traffic. When learning how to run a Python script in PowerShell for marketing, proxies let you test localized content, bypass geo-restrictions, and gather accurate regional data. 「Obtain residential proxy IP services」 to see the difference.
3. What's the most common mistake when combining Python and PowerShell?
Marketers often neglect proper path configuration, causing scripts to fail when scheduled. Always use absolute paths in scheduled tasks and verify Python is in your system PATH. Our team can provide pre-configured solutions that avoid these pitfalls.